## Warranty-Cost Overrun — Helvex Line (Managers Only)

Summary for the incoming director: warranty claims on the Helvex 400 series ran well above provision this quarter. Root cause traced to a faulty seal batch from the Dunmore plant. Corrective rework is underway; supplier negotiations pending. Claim volume should normalize within two quarters. Details in the claims log. The confidential business note appears below.

confidential, fahag-yahap: Project Raleth slips by six weeks because of the tooling delay.

Quarterly Planning Note — Q3

Branch managers: the outsourcing of customer-support operations to Brindlehurst Solutions begins in October. Branches will retain local escalation duties only; routine queries route to the shared desk. Training materials arrive mid-September. Staffing adjustments will be handled case by case with HR support. Expect a dip in response metrics during the first month. Please treat the item appended below as strictly confidential.

board note of baweg-bawig: Project Tamath slips by six weeks because of the audit delay.

# Relevance tuning notes — Findable search stack
# Hey support folks: if customers complain about weird ranking, check
# BOOST_RECENCY and SYNONYM_PACK first before escalating. Most "search
# is broken" tickets are just a stale synonym pack. Values below are
# safe to tweak on staging; don't touch prod without a heads-up in the
# tuning channel. The ranking service also needs its API credential
# set here, which goes on the following line:

vault entry, yahif-yajep: COURIER_KEY29=b802bdf8034096b65a51c6ba5abe2

- Factories now seed deterministically per test; pass `seed:` to override.
- Added trait composition: `build(:order, :overdue, :bulk)`.
- Dropped support for the legacy Marwood fixtures format — run `fabrikit migrate` once per repo.
- Circular association detection is now an error, not a warning.

New team members: read `docs/quickstart.md` before writing factories. Broken builds after upgrade are almost always the rename. Questions and review requests go to the maintainer named below.

named custodian: Brivan Eliath Quenox Frador